Harassment in the workplace can take many forms, including bullying, discrimination, sexual harassment, and verbal abuse It can have a detrimental impact on the mental health and well-being of employees, leading to increased absenteeism, decreased productivity, and high staff turnover rates In the UK, the Equality Act 2010 legally protects employees from discrimination and harassment based on certain characteristics such as age, gender, race, religion, and disability Employers have a duty of care to ensure that their employees are not subjected to harassment of any kind.

Anti harassment training plays a crucial role in creating a culture of respect and understanding within an organization By educating employees on what behaviors are considered harassing or discriminatory, organizations can prevent instances of harassment from occurring in the first place Training can cover topics such as the legal definitions of harassment, the consequences of engaging in such behavior, and how to report incidents of harassment It can also provide employees with the tools and resources they need to respond effectively to harassment when they witness it.

In the UK, the Equality and Human Rights Commission recommends that all employees receive anti harassment training as part of their induction process This ensures that new hires are aware of the organization’s policies and procedures around harassment and discrimination from the outset Additionally, regular refresher training should be provided to all employees to ensure that they are up to date on the latest guidance and best practices By making anti harassment training a priority, organizations can demonstrate their commitment to creating a respectful and inclusive workplace for everyone.
